"Alive today and so grateful"

I became unwell and breathless after finishing work on a Friday.   I wasn't sure what was wrong with me, so I consulted my sister who is a staff nurse in another Hospital. On the following Sunday, instead of having a romantic meal with my husband I was telephoning NHS 111. After the advice given I was advised to go to out of hours 24 service in Hamilton for an assessment and to pack a bag. I never got time to pack tbh as a Doctor from Hamilton had been looking at my details and immediately advised I need an ambulance, I refused as felt well enough to get my husband to take me to A& E.

On arrival it all happened so quickly from there from getting a Covid-19 test, BP, bloods taken, Oxygen levels etc. After waiting I was then advised being taken to a ward ACU. More tests done, CT scan arranged for Monday morning. The news was traumatic for me I was advised massive lung clot in centre of my lungs. I was immediately transferred to ICU to be observed closely due to the risk of my life. Very terrifying experience. Throughout my ordeal every staff member who supported me was fantastic and I was totally updated throughout. I can't thank all of the staff involved enough, they saved my life-they sprang into action as soon as I was admitted. I had two CT scans second one precaution in case of stomach malignant. I had a third Covid-19 test also before leaving the Hospital. The Doctors were amazing, no stone was left unturned and the nursing staff couldn't do enough. From the cleaning of my room and the dinners and care I got. NHS you should all be proud, every staff member, we are talking total team work here. A massive thank-you from me and my family for the excellent care I received. I am alive today and so grateful. xxxxx
